Output 35881037f106a4a987099a97f8b85c9073592e85a29ea917693cd2fae0d8c871:0

value
1976795904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 238dbb86f9d99b88e563210266780b64991d2fb4 OP_EQUALVERIFY OP_CHECKSIG
address
14EzSTqmxKcgED8uW6mwADheYATVdtjst3
transaction
35881037f106a4a987099a97f8b85c9073592e85a29ea917693cd2fae0d8c871
spent
true